Skip to content

Releases: coreui/coreui-angular

v2.6.0

16 Oct 17:09
Compare
Choose a tag to compare
v2.6.0

refactor(SidebarNavLink)

  • fix(SidebarNavLink): nav link target doesn't work through appHtmlAttr - thanks @Hagith #79
  • fix(SidebarNavLink): allow link parameters array
  • refactor(SidebarNavLink): extract disabled link type
  • fix(SidebarNavLink): test for item.attributes presence
  • refactor(SidebarNavLink): add item.href for explicit external links
  • refactor(SidebarNavLink): extract SidebarNavLinkContent component
  • fix(SidebarNavBadge): add missing badge.class prop
  • refactor(SidebarNavLink): active class workaround with NavigationEnd Observable
  • refactor(SidebarNavLink): add pipe SidebarNavLink
  • feat(SidebarNavLink): allow routerLink properties as item.linkProps
export interface INavLinkProps {
  queryParams?: {[k: string]: any};
  fragment?: string;
  queryParamsHandling?: 'merge' | 'preserve' | '';
  preserveFragment?: boolean;
  skipLocationChange?: boolean;
  replaceUrl?: boolean;
  state?: {[k: string]: any};
}

v2.5.5

24 Sep 17:15
ebc76e1
Compare
Choose a tag to compare
v2.5.5
  • fix: regression build issue - Please add a @NgModule annotation
v2.5.4
  • refactor(sidebar): move INavData interface to @coreui/angular library - thanks @Fredx87 #72
  • refactor(sidebar): add pipe SidebarNavItemClass #74
  • refactor(sidebar): use pipes in sidebar-nav-dropdown - thanks @coyoteecd #74
  • refactor(sidebar): use pipes in sidebar-nav-items pipe #74
  • refactor(sidebar): sidebar-nav-service cleanup
  • refactor: public_api
dependencies update
  • update @angular/animations to ^8.2.7
  • update @angular/common to ^8.2.7
  • update @angular/compiler to ^8.2.7
  • update @angular/core to ^8.2.7
  • update @angular/forms to ^8.2.7
  • update @angular/platform-browser to ^8.2.7
  • update @angular/platform-browser-dynamic to ^8.2.7
  • update @angular/router to ^8.2.7
  • update rxjs to ^6.5.3
  • update zone.js to ^0.10.2
  • update @angular-devkit/build-angular to ^0.803.5
  • update @angular-devkit/build-ng-packagr to ^0.803.5
  • update @angular/cli to ^8.3.5
  • update @angular/compiler-cli to ^8.2.7
  • update @angular/language-service to ^8.2.7
  • update @types/jasmine to ^3.4.0
  • update @types/node to ^11.13.20
  • update codelyzer to ^5.1.1
  • update karma to ^4.3.0
  • update ng-packagr to ^5.5.1
  • update ts-node to ^8.4.1
  • update tsickle to ~0.37.0
  • update tslint to ^5.20.0

v2.5.3

02 Aug 17:02
bd5fd37
Compare
Choose a tag to compare
v2.5.3
  • fix(sidebar): performance issues with app-sidebar-nav components due to ngClass bindings - thanks @coyoteecd #74
  • fix(sidebar): app-sidebar-nav-label.component sets an incomplete variant style - thanks @coyoteecd closes #75
dependencies update
  • update @angular/animations to ^8.2.0
  • update @angular/common to ^8.2.0
  • update @angular/compiler to ^8.2.0
  • update @angular/core to ^8.2.0
  • update @angular/forms to ^8.2.0
  • update @angular/platform-browser to ^8.2.0
  • update @angular/platform-browser-dynamic to ^8.2.0
  • update @angular/router to ^8.2.0
  • update zone.js to ~0.10.0
  • update @angular-devkit/build-angular to ^0.802.0
  • update @angular-devkit/build-ng-packagr to ^0.802.0
  • update @angular/cli to ^8.2.0
  • update @angular/compiler-cli to ^8.2.0
  • update @angular/language-service to ^8.2.0
  • update @types/jasmine to ^3.3.16
  • update @types/node to ^11.13.18
  • update karma to ^4.2.0
  • update karma-coverage-istanbul-reporter to ^2.1.0
  • update ng-packagr to ^5.4.3
  • update tsickle to ^0.36.0
  • update tslint to ^5.18.0

v2.5.2

19 Jun 21:10
839f1f4
Compare
Choose a tag to compare
v2.5.2
  • refactor(AppHeader): add reactive toggler class based on breakpoint
    usage: set toggler breakpoint
<app-header
  [sidebarToggler]="'lg'"
  [asideMenuToggler]="'md'">
</app-header>
dependencies update
  • update @angular/animations to ^8.0.2
  • update @angular/common to ^8.0.2
  • update @angular/compiler to ^8.0.2
  • update @angular/core to ^8.0.2
  • update @angular/forms to ^8.0.2
  • update @angular/platform-browser to ^8.0.2
  • update @angular/platform-browser-dynamic to ^8.0.2
  • update @angular/router to ^8.0.2
  • update @angular-devkit/build-angular to ^0.800.3
  • update @angular-devkit/build-ng-packagr to ^0.800.3
  • update @angular/cli to ^8.0.3
  • update @angular/compiler-cli to ^8.0.2
  • update @angular/language-service to ^8.0.2
  • update @types/node to ^11.13.14
  • update ts-node to ^8.3.0
  • update tslib to ^1.10.0

v2.5.1

07 Jun 13:18
a9a2abb
Compare
Choose a tag to compare
v2.5.1
  • fix(appHtmlAttr): cannot remove html attribute,
    usage: attributes: {hidden: null} removes attribute hidden
dependencies update
  • update @angular-devkit/build-angular to ^0.800.2
  • update @angular-devkit/build-ng-packagr to ^0.800.2
  • update @angular/cli to ^8.0.2
  • update ng-packagr to ^5.3.0

v2.5.0

03 Jun 17:06
Compare
Choose a tag to compare
v2.5.0 for Angular 8
  • chore: upgrade to Angular 8.0 - thanks @dennisameling
  • chore: move browserslist file
  • chore(tslint): cleanup unused/deprecated rules
  • chore(tsconfig): target update
dependencies update
  • update @angular/animations to ^8.0.0
  • update @angular/common to ^8.0.0
  • update @angular/compiler to ^8.0.0
  • update @angular/core to ^8.0.0
  • update @angular/forms to ^8.0.0
  • update @angular/platform-browser to ^8.0.0
  • update @angular/platform-browser-dynamic to ^8.0.0
  • update @angular/router to ^8.0.0
  • update core-js to ^2.6.9
  • update rxjs to ^6.5.2
  • update zone.js to ~0.9.1
  • update @angular-devkit/build-angular to ~0.800.1
  • update @angular-devkit/build-ng-packagr to ~0.800.1
  • update @angular/cli to ^8.0.1
  • update @angular/compiler-cli to ^8.0.0
  • update @angular/language-service to ^8.0.0
  • update @types/jasmine to ^3.3.13
  • update @types/node to ^11.13.13
  • update codelyzer to ^5.0.1
  • update jasmine-core to ~3.4.0
  • update ng-packagr to ^5.2.0
  • update tsickle to ^0.35.0
  • update typescript to ~3.4.5

v2.4.5

20 Mar 14:52
b3a9121
Compare
Choose a tag to compare
v2.4.5
  • chore(readme): npm badges
  • chore(readme): prerequisites
  • update: @angular/animations to ^7.2.10
  • update: @angular/common to ^7.2.10
  • update: @angular/compiler to ^7.2.10
  • update: @angular/core to ^7.2.10
  • update: @angular/forms to ^7.2.10
  • update: @angular/http to ^7.2.10
  • update: @angular/platform-browser to ^7.2.10
  • update: @angular/platform-browser-dynamic to ^7.2.10
  • update: @angular/router to ^7.2.10
  • update: @angular/compiler-cli to ^7.2.10
  • update: @angular/language-service to ^7.2.10
  • update: @types/jasmine to ^3.3.12
  • update: @types/node to ^11.11.4

v2.4.4

18 Mar 14:25
Compare
Choose a tag to compare
v2.4.4
  • fix(breadcrumb.service): wrong import from rxjs causes overhead in resulted bundle - fixes #22
    thanks: @sparun160782 @lscorcia @nazar-kuzo
  • update: @angular/animations to ^7.2.9
  • update: @angular/common to ^7.2.9
  • update: @angular/compiler to ^7.2.9
  • update: @angular/core to ^7.2.9
  • update: @angular/forms to ^7.2.9
  • update: @angular/http to ^7.2.9
  • update: @angular/platform-browser to ^7.2.9
  • update: @angular/platform-browser-dynamic to ^7.2.9
  • update: @angular/router to ^7.2.9
  • update: @angular-devkit/build-angular to ^0.13.6
  • update: @angular-devkit/build-ng-packagr to ^0.13.6
  • update: @angular/cli to ^7.3.6
  • update: @angular/compiler-cli to ^7.2.9
  • update: @angular/language-service to ^7.2.9
  • update: @types/jasmine to ^3.3.10
  • update: @types/node to ^11.11.3
  • update: karma to ^4.0.1
  • update: ts-node to ^8.0.3
  • update: tslint to ^5.14.0

v2.4.3

22 Feb 18:15
Compare
Choose a tag to compare
v2.4.3
  • update: @coreui/coreui to ^2.1.7
  • update: @angular/animations to ^7.2.6
  • update: @angular/common to ^7.2.6
  • update: @angular/compiler to ^7.2.6
  • update: @angular/core to ^7.2.6
  • update: @angular/forms to ^7.2.6
  • update: @angular/http to ^7.2.6
  • update: @angular/platform-browser to ^7.2.6
  • update: @angular/platform-browser-dynamic to ^7.2.6
  • update: @angular/router to ^7.2.6
  • update: @angular-devkit/build-angular to ^0.13.3
  • update: @angular-devkit/build-ng-packagr to ^0.13.3
  • update: @angular/cli to ^7.3.3
  • update: @angular/compiler-cli to ^7.2.6
  • update: @angular/language-service to ^7.2.6

v2.4.2

19 Feb 14:08
Compare
Choose a tag to compare
v2.4.2
  • feat(header): use routerLink for brand instead of href attribute #51 - thanks @Hagith